Peter In Bournemouth we had no objections at all. I would advise getting a friendly architect who can draw some 'pretties' in watercolours for a presentation at the planning meeting. This helped a lot as they could see what they were in for. It is also useful to put over the 'local amenity attraction' element as councils like that community-bonding stuff.
